Fires when Bramwick order-service pool utilization exceeds 95% for 5 minutes. Reviewer checklist: new code must release connections in finally blocks, avoid holding a connection across external calls, and respect the 30s checkout timeout. Pool max is 40 per pod; do not raise it without load-test evidence. Common culprit: batch jobs grabbing connections in loops. Recent regression came from the refund retry path — see ticket ORD-1182. If the alert recurs after your change merges, loop in the data-platform rotation below.

pager mailbox: silael.sorwyn.tamius@zemvarsys.corp

## Step 4: Provision the Flag Store

Before enabling the Larkspur rollout framework in production, verify that the flag evaluation service writes audit records to an isolated schema, not the shared application database. Confirm that the service account has only INSERT and SELECT grants, and that TLS is enforced on every hop. Once grants are reviewed and logged, configure the audit writer by supplying the following connection string.

replica DSN, yahaf-yagaf: mongodb://tamath_svc:a2netSk3RZMuTj@db-d084.novacsoft.internal:5432/ralmir

## Account recovery — Clinic reminder job (Bellmoor Health scheduler)

If the service account running the appointment reminder job is locked out, reminders stop sending within one cycle. Reviewers checking the recovery PR should confirm: the job is paused first, the queue is drained, and no duplicate reminders will fire on resume. Recovery is performed through the Bellmoor ops console using the break-glass flow; two approvals are required. After approvals are logged, unlock the service account keystore with the recovery passphrase below.

unlock words, hahip-yagef: zorok-novmir-zorix-silax

# Settings: Orchardpin dependency policy
# External plugin authors: pin exact versions only. No ranges, no wildcards.
# The Orchardpin resolver rejects unpinned manifests at publish time.
# Pins are validated against the registry snapshot nightly; drift gets flagged.
# Lockfile overrides require a policy exception recorded in the exceptions table.
# That table lives in the registry database, reachable via the string below.

primary connection of yagep-kahip = redis://giliel_svc:zYiKsLL2PLpfPL@db-348f.xolmarsys.corp:5432/fenwyn